
C#
芝麻开花不开门
这个作者很懒,什么都没留下…
展开
-
变量的命名
1、命名规则:(1)必须以字母,或@符号开头,不要以数字开头(2)后面可以跟任意字母、数字、下划线(3)注意:变量名不可与关键字重复;在C#中区分大小写;同一个变量名不允许重复定义2、定义变量时,变量名要有意义3、C#变量命名编码规范——Camel命名法:首个单词的首字母小写,其余单词的首字母大写。4、Pascal命名规范:每一个单词第一字母都大写原创 2017-02-11 20:41:54 · 878 阅读 · 47 评论 -
FlowLayoutPanel内的控件调换顺序
FlowLayoutPanel控件沿着水平或者垂直流方向排列其内容。FlowLayoutPanel 是流式布局面板。可以实现动态的添加控件,实现响应式的布局排版。如何调整FlowLayoutPanel内控件的排列顺序呢?很简单:原创 2018-04-29 19:45:27 · 5082 阅读 · 18 评论 -
DataGridView控件中至少有一列没有单元格模板
小背景一个Form窗体,一个Button按钮,一个DataGridView控件,我要实现的是点击按钮,DataGridView控件增加一列。第一次尝试 private void button1_Click(object sender, EventArgs e) { DataGridViewColumn column = ne原创 2018-04-04 17:01:30 · 5079 阅读 · 17 评论 -
多线程简单介绍
线程 线程被定义为程序的执行路径。每个线程都定义了一个独特的控制流。如果您的应用程序涉及到复杂的和耗时的操作,那么设置不同的线程执行路径往往是有益的,每个线程执行特定的工作。线程是轻量级进程。一个使用线程的常见实例是现代操作系统中并行编程的实现。使用线程节省了 CPU 周期的浪费,同时提高了应用程序的效率。到目前为止我们编写的程序是一个单线程作为应用程序的运行实例的单一的过程运行的。但原创 2018-04-15 21:07:11 · 286 阅读 · 22 评论 -
static【C#】
静态类与非静态类的重要区别在于静态类不能实例化,也就是说,不能使用 new 关键字创建静态类类型的变量。在声明一个类时使用static关键字,具有两个方面的意义:首先,它防止程序员写代码来实例化该静态类;其次,它防止在类的内部声明任何实例字段或方法。原创 2017-06-17 16:23:19 · 549 阅读 · 40 评论 -
数组【C#】
数组的概念:所谓数组,是相同数据类型的元素按一定顺序排列的集合。若将有限个类型相同的变量的集合命名,那么这个名称为数组名。组成数组的各个变量称为数组的分量,也称为数组的元素,有时也称为下标变量。用于区分数组的各个元素的数字编号称为下标。在C#中,数组的声明可以有几下几种方式:原创 2017-05-26 17:10:01 · 608 阅读 · 44 评论 -
枚举【C#】
什么是枚举?枚举简单的说是一种数据类型,只不过这种数据类型只包含自定义的特定数据,它是一组有共同特性的数据的集合。举个例子,颜色也可以定义成枚举类型,它可以包含你定义的任何颜色,当需要的时候,只需要通过枚举调用即可,另外比如说季节(春夏秋冬)、星期(星期一到星期日)、性别(男、女)等等这些具有共同投特征的数据都可以定义枚举。原创 2017-05-07 12:56:08 · 633 阅读 · 28 评论 -
字符串转换成数字的方法【C#】
在C#中,经常需要将字符串转换成数字,暂时总结三种方法:原创 2017-04-23 17:16:27 · 29359 阅读 · 44 评论 -
隐式转换与显式转换【C#】
隐式转换:所谓隐式转换,就是系统默认的转换,其本质是小存储容量数据类型自动转换为大存储容量数据类型。参与运算(算数运算和赋值运算)的操作数和结果类型必须一致,当不一致时,满足两个条件时,系统会自动完成类型转换(隐式转换):(1)两种类型兼容,比如都是数字类型(2)目标类型大于源类型,例如,double>int对于表达式而言,如果一个操作数是double型,则整个表达式可提升原创 2017-04-16 19:14:18 · 1154 阅读 · 42 评论 -
关于datetime中毫秒问题
使用 selectdatetimefromtable 时,查询出来的datetime默认值只精确到秒('2019-03-2909:09:01')如果需要精确到毫秒呢?使用上述语句查询到的结果中,当然也是有办法获取到毫秒数的。不过,还有一种更为直接的方法.使用 selectconvert(char,datetime,21)asdtfromtable这时,就可以获...原创 2019-03-29 21:21:59 · 4053 阅读 · 2 评论